[PATCH 1/3] dwrite/tests: Fix fallback builder test skip
Nikolay Sivov
nsivov at codeweavers.com
Fri Sep 22 07:34:50 CDT 2017
Signed-off-by: Nikolay Sivov <nsivov at codeweavers.com>
---
dlls/dwrite/tests/layout.c | 12 +++++-------
1 file changed, 5 insertions(+), 7 deletions(-)
diff --git a/dlls/dwrite/tests/layout.c b/dlls/dwrite/tests/layout.c
index ba3e852664..493eaf317f 100644
--- a/dlls/dwrite/tests/layout.c
+++ b/dlls/dwrite/tests/layout.c
@@ -4672,17 +4672,15 @@ static void test_FontFallbackBuilder(void)
hr = IDWriteFactory_QueryInterface(factory, &IID_IDWriteFactory2, (void**)&factory2);
IDWriteFactory_Release(factory);
- if (factory2) {
- EXPECT_REF(factory2, 1);
- hr = IDWriteFactory2_CreateFontFallbackBuilder(factory2, &builder);
- EXPECT_REF(factory2, 2);
- }
-
if (hr != S_OK) {
- skip("IDWriteFontFallbackBuilder is not supported\n");
+ win_skip("IDWriteFontFallbackBuilder is not supported\n");
return;
}
+ EXPECT_REF(factory2, 1);
+ hr = IDWriteFactory2_CreateFontFallbackBuilder(factory2, &builder);
+ EXPECT_REF(factory2, 2);
+
fallback = NULL;
EXPECT_REF(factory2, 2);
EXPECT_REF(builder, 1);
--
2.14.1
More information about the wine-patches
mailing list